Members to Convene
In San Antonio Next Week

The National Fenestration Rating Council (NFRC) will host its Fall membership meeting Nov. 16-19, 2009, at the Sheraton Gunter Hotel in San Antonio.

Join Us in Celebrating 20 Years
Since its creation in 1989, the NFRC has been a leader in the implementation of rating and certification programs for fenestration products and energy performance. The Fall Membership Meeting will include a celebration of the organization’s 20th anniversary with special events, including live music and other surprises.

The meeting starts on Monday, November 16, with a new member orientation, followed by task group meetings and the opening session, which will feature keynote speaker Chris Mathis. Chris has been a part of NFRC since the very beginning and will share memories of the organization’s early years.

Green Building Our Way to a Bright Future
During the Regulatory Affairs & Marketing (RAM) Committee block on Monday afternoon, Build San Antonio Green Executive Director Anita Ledbetter will give a presentation on her organization’s latest initiatives. NFRC will also team with Build San Antonio Green to continue the tradition of giving back to its meetings’ host cities. Meeting attendees can make voluntary donations to Build San Antonio Green in return for special, Texas-themed lapel pin souvenirs featuring the NFRC logo. The Build San Antonio Green program is a partnership of local governments, utilities, and other community stakeholders that aims to make and keep green building affordable.

Business will pick back up again on Wednesday morning with the remaining committee and subcommittee meetings.

This year, there are 26 ballots up for review and approval including:

  • Two ballots under the Research & Technology Committee.
  • More than a dozen ballots during the Technical Committee block, including one under the Annual Energy Performance Subcommittee, four under the SHGC Subcommittee, seven under the U-factor Subcommittee, and two under the Attachment Subcommittee.
  • Many ballots related to NFRC 700 during the Ratings Committee block.

The Thursday morning NFRC Board Meeting will bring the Fall Membership Meeting to a close.
